Nevada took a 25-point defeat the last time they faced off against Pleasant Hill, but this time they managed to keep it close and that made all the difference. The Tigers sure made it a nail-biter, but they managed to escape with a 21-19 win over the Roosters/Chicks on Friday. Given the Tigers' advantage in MaxPreps' Missouri football rankings (they are ranked 45th, while the Roosters/Chicks are ranked 154th) , the result wasn't entirely unexpected.
Nevada's victory bumped their record up to 6-3. As for Pleasant Hill, they have been struggling recently as they've lost five of their last six matchups. That's put a noticeable dent in their 2-7 record this season.
